Goethestraße


Goethestraße is a luxury shopping street in the city centre of Frankfurt, Germany, located between Opernplatz and Börsenstraße and Goetheplatz in the district of Innenstadt and within the Opera Quarter and the broader central business district known as the Bankenviertel. It is a parallel street of Freßgass and located in the immediate vicinity of Kaiserhofstraße. The street is Germany's third-busiest luxury shopping street.
The street was constructed between 1892 and 1894 and named for Johann Wolfgang von Goethe.

Public transport

Goethestraße is served by nearby Frankfurt Hauptwache station and the Alte Oper station of the Frankfurt U-Bahn.

Businesses

Retail establishments in Goethestraße include: Armani, Bally, Bulgari, Burberry, Chanel, Ermenegildo Zegna, Gucci, Hermès, Hugo Boss, Jil Sander, Louis Vuitton, Longchamp, Jimmy Choo, Montblanc, Patek Philippe, Prada, Salvatore Ferragamo, Tiffany & Co., Tumi, Versace, and Vertu.
